Dining Centers

The South Madison Coalition of the Elderly manages five dining centers that provide nutritious meals and various recreational and educational programs for individuals 60 years old and above. The centers are open Monday through Friday, with the exception of the Bayview Site. Reservations are needed 24 hours in advance and can be made by calling the site or Coalition office.

Home delivered meals are also available for eligible older adults living in the apartment where each nutrition site is located.
